먼저 npm init -y로 node.js의 프로젝트를 생성 하고, public 폴더를 만든 후 밑에 html 파일 두개를 만든다.
첫번째 사이트의 주소는 "/" 로 하기로 했고, 두번째 사이트의 주소는 "/newTest" 로 하기로 했다.
public 폴더 사용을 선언하고, app.get()으로 해당 주소에 접속할 시, res.send()로 원하는 html 창을 띄우게 한다.
그리고 app.listen()으로 특정 포트에서 서버가 실행되도록 하였다.
그 결과 로컬호스트 홈페이지로 가면 첫번째 사이트가 뜨고, a태그를 클릭하면 특정 주소의 사이트가 뜬다.
'Node.js' 카테고리의 다른 글
[Node.js] fs 모듈 (1) | 2024.03.22 |
---|---|
[Node.js] path 모듈 (0) | 2024.03.22 |
[Node.js] Express 서버에 스케줄러 만들기 (0) | 2024.03.18 |
[Node.js] Express 라우터를 모듈로 분리하기 (0) | 2024.03.18 |
[Node.js] Express 여러 미들웨어 사용 (1) | 2024.03.14 |